Ingredients List

Ingredient Amount Substitution Options
All-purpose flour 2 cups Whole wheat flour for added fiber
Sugar 1 ½ cups Brown sugar for a deeper flavor
Unsalted butter 1 cup (softened) Coconut oil for a dairy-free version
Eggs 4 large Flax eggs for a vegan alternative
Sour cream 1/2 cup Greek yogurt for added protein
Vanilla extract 1 teaspoon Almond extract for a different flavor profile
Baking powder 1 teaspoon Page flour for a gluten-free version
Fresh strawberries 1 ½ cups (sliced) Frozen strawberries (thawed) if fresh are unavailable

Timing

This Strawberry Pound Cake is not only delicious but also relatively quick to make. The total time required for preparation and baking is approximately 90 minutes, which is 20% less time than the average cake recipe. Here’s the breakdown:

  • Preparation time: 20 minutes
  • Baking time: 50 minutes
  • Cooling time: 20 minutes

Step-by-Step Instructions

Step 1: Prepare Your Ingredients

Start by preheating your oven to 350°F (175°C). Gather all your ingredients and ensure that the butter is softened for easy mixing. This step sets the tone for a fluffy pound cake!

Step 2: Mix the Dry Ingredients

In a large bowl, whisk together the all-purpose flour, baking powder, and a pinch of salt. This ensures even distribution and avoids clumping in your batter.

Step 3: Cream the Butter and Sugar

Using an electric mixer, cream the softened butter and sugar together for about 3-4 minutes until it’s light and fluffy. This aeration is key to achieving the ideal cake texture!

Step 4: Add the Eggs and Sour Cream

One by one, add the eggs to the butter mixture, mixing well after each addition. Then, incorporate the sour cream and vanilla extract. Mix until well combined.

Step 5: Combine Dry and Wet Ingredients

Gradually fold in the dry ingredients from Step 2 into the wet mixture. Be gentle; overmixing can lead to a dense cake. The batter should be thick and creamy.

Step 6: Fold in the Strawberries

Gently fold in the sliced strawberries to maintain their shape and give your cake that beautiful marbled effect when baked. You can reserve some strawberry slices for garnishing.

Step 7: Pour and Bake

Pour the batter into a greased loaf pan, smoothing the top with a spatula. Bake in the preheated oven for 50 minutes or until a toothpick inserted into the center comes out clean.

Step 8: Cool and Serve

Once baked, allow the cake to cool in the pan for about 10 minutes before transferring it to a wire rack. Let it cool completely; this helps the flavors settle before slicing.

Common Mistakes to Avoid

  • Overmixing the Batter: This can lead to a tough texture. Aim for just combined ingredients.
  • Not Using Room Temperature Ingredients: Cold ingredients can cause the butter to seize, affecting the cake’s rise.
  • Incorrect Oven Temperature: Always preheat and use an oven thermometer for accuracy to ensure even baking.

Storing Tips for the Recipe

To store your Strawberry Pound Cake, wrap it tightly in plastic wrap or aluminum foil and place it in an airtight container. It can be stored at room temperature for up to 3 days or in the refrigerator for up to a week. If you have leftovers, consider freezing individual slices. Just thaw them at room temperature when you’re ready to enjoy a piece.

FAQs

A: Can I use frozen strawberries in this recipe?

Yes, frozen strawberries can be used if fresh ones are unavailable. Just ensure they are thawed and drained before incorporating them into the batter.

B: How do I know when my pound cake is done baking?

Insert a toothpick into the center of the cake. If it comes out clean or with just a few crumbs, your cake is ready!

C: Can I make this recipe gluten-free?

Absolutely! You can substitute all-purpose flour with a gluten-free flour blend or almond flour to make it gluten-free while maintaining a delightful flavor.

D: Is there a low-fat version of this cake?

Yes! You can create a lower-fat version by using unsweetened applesauce instead of butter and reducing the sugar content. The cake will be slightly different in texture but still delicious!
